    Two reasons:

    One: When you click in an area that has wayshrines and houses overlapping, a dropdown displaying the options appears. It takes a little longer, true, but isn't hard to do.

    Two: Teleporting to a house costs no money at all. Either you don't own the house and you're brought to Preview mode, in which case you can leave the house to be put right back where you were with a bit of time lost. Or, you own the house, in which case it's a free teleport to the spot the wayshrine was at anyway. The only part of that equation that costs money is the wayshrine part, assuming you're not coming from another wayshrine... in which case, if you own the house, you should be using the house anyway.

    Not saying the ability to toggle houses on the map wouldn't be great (especially the ones you don't own)... just that this isn't the reason to justify it.

    I haven't had this problem. If you click on or close to both you get a drop-down asking which you want to go to, so you can just pick the wayshrine if you don't want to go to the house.

    (Although if it's a house you own you should always pick the house because then it's free.)
    Katahdin wrote: »
    Pretty sure there is a way to turn off map icons. Open to world map and look on the right side. I think there are map filters over there.

    But that classes houses as wayshrines so you can't turn them off seperately. Either you have houses AND wayshrines or neither.

    On PC there's an addon which hides them, but I don't think there's any way to do it on consoles.
